Output 7430369beb9689276b90a87aadfc755750228c1f2f79902e8d0085d476818397:6

value
1740197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ee50985b803fc1bcc6fe24bc83870a72ddaeb6 OP_EQUAL
address
3QUXfiMczoixFaYgibWydBk83JFjkd4o68
transaction
7430369beb9689276b90a87aadfc755750228c1f2f79902e8d0085d476818397
spent
true